Output 5660d32b7a960783c25102e6f06c17dff3849dcd4d7d9fb54950dcd18a8b8c2d:0

value
2156851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4aaf50d036bbc3bd3ff4970de6f2b4869dfa0a1 OP_EQUAL
address
3KcuATacbH9Vr8BuPQRT15EEgBG1CAKoDq
transaction
5660d32b7a960783c25102e6f06c17dff3849dcd4d7d9fb54950dcd18a8b8c2d
spent
true